Hello.
Please tell me how I can be configured so that the information was collected only for specific cluster and business view not display other clusters in the vcenter.
Settings tab in the VI management servers as I understand taken from Veeam ONE. Now there is one added vсenter and business view displays all information on it.
Tried in Veeam ONE disable monitoring of other datacenters and clusters, they moved to the status of excluded, but still visible in Business VIEW and Veeam ONE with status (excluded)

Thank you for help.

Hello Igor,

Can you please clarify your request? Do you have a multi-tenant environment? It is not possible to completely hide all collected objects, but you can try to do the following:

1. Open Business View website
2. Navigate to Workspace tab
3. Either use exclusions from categorization or leave the required objects as uncategorized

In this case you will not see these objects in Monitor Client in the Business View tab.

Let me know if that helps!

We assign permissions on the cluster level.
In Veeam Monitor Client all good, visible only specific cluster.
As far as I know the data in a Business view come by job from Veeam Reporter
But in Veeam Reporter - job of collected data failed with error:
Failed to RetrieveProperties: "". Insufficient privileges. You need to have 'System.Read' privilege on 'Folder:group-d1' object.
